Partner of the Finnish pharmaceutical industry

Sweco has been a partner of the Finnish pharmaceutical industry for over 20 years. In projects, we combine local expertise with the extensive experience of the international group. We serve pharmaceutical industry operators who manufacture both medicines and active pharmaceutical ingredients.

Our experts have extensive experience working in and operating various pharmaceutical facilities and manufacturing environments, and we understand the requirements and special characteristics of the industry. Projects take into account pharmaceutical material and design specifications, as well as validation, EU, FDA, and GMP requirements.

Design Services for the Pharmaceutical Industry

Our comprehensive design services include structural, plant, and process design for industrial facilities, as well as design for pharmaceutical production lines, equipment, and utility systems. We also offer specialized expertise in the design of cleanrooms and aseptic sterile and injectable manufacturing systems for the pharmaceutical industry.

GMP Requirements. Our designers have extensive experience in both fieldwork within the pharmaceutical industry and understanding the quality and safety requirements of manufacturing, production, and distribution practices in various countries (Good Manufacturing Practice, GMP). Particular attention is given to systematic documentation.

Cleanroom Design. Our structural, electrical, HVAC, and automation designers specialized in pharmaceutical industry projects are responsible for designing cleanrooms of various quality levels as well as the surrounding areas. Our supervisors are also accustomed to working in cleanroom environments.

Utility Systems Design. We offer specialized expertise in the design of chemical and utility systems for the pharmaceutical industry. We design systems such as pure steam and CIP systems, as well as high-quality pure water systems (WFI, Water for Injection).

Services for API manufacturing facilities (Active pharmaceutical ingredients)

API manufacturing facilities receive comprehensive support from Sweco in process, plant, equipment, and safety design, as well as project management. Our expertise also extends to the management of VOC gases and the design of steam and condensate systems.

Services for the manufacturing pharmaceutical industry

We offer the manufacturing pharmaceutical industry comprehensive design and project management services, as well as specialized expertise in validations, safety design, and production line design. We are also proficient in the design of CIP, PW, WFI, and pure steam systems for pharmaceutical facilities.

Project management and supervision for pharmaceutical facility projects

Our project management services cover all aspects of project leadership, construction management, and supervision. A pharmaceutical facility project can be executed as an EPCM contract, where we also handle overall design. Key components of our project management services include real-time monitoring of costs, schedule, and quality, as well as delivery and installation supervision.

Supporting services for the pharmaceutical industry

We support pharmaceutical industry stakeholders with multidisciplinary support services ranging from logistics planning to risk management. Our experts specialize in chemical, product, and machine safety. Precise product labeling and the design of material flows within the facility support product traceability.
